資源簡介
PS:里面附有數據庫,用sqlserver附加。eclipse導入后改一下jdbc賬號密碼即可運行。所有錯誤本人均調式完成。

代碼片段和文件信息
package?com.dao;
import?java.sql.*;
import?java.util.*;
import?com.tool.JDBConnection;
import?com.tool.FinalConstants;
import?com.domain.AfficheForm;
//對公告信息的操作
public?class?AfficheDao?{
??private?Connection?connection?=?null;?//定義連接的對象
??private?PreparedStatement?ps?=?null;?//定義預準備的對象
??private?JDBConnection?jdbc?=?null;?//定義數據庫連接對象
??public?AfficheDao()?{
????jdbc?=?new?JDBConnection();
????connection?=?jdbc.connection;?//利用構造方法取得數據庫連接
??}
??//刪除的方法
??public?void?deleteAffiche(Integer?id)?{
????try?{
??????ps?=?connection.prepareStatement(FinalConstants.affice_delete);
??????ps.setInt(1?id.intValue());
??????ps.executeUpdate();
??????ps.close();
????}
????catch?(SQLException?ex)?{
????}
??}
??//修改的方法
??public?void?updateAffiche(AfficheForm?form)?{
????try?{
??????ps?=?connection.prepareStatement(FinalConstants.affice_update);
??????ps.setString(1?form.getName());
??????ps.setString(2?form.getContent());
??????ps.setInt(3?form.getId().intValue());
??????ps.executeUpdate();
??????ps.close();
????}
????catch?(SQLException?ex)?{
????}
??}
//添加的方法
??public?void?insertAffiche(AfficheForm?form)?{
????try?{
??????ps?=?connection.prepareStatement(FinalConstants.affice_insert);
??????ps.setString(1?form.getName());
??????ps.setString(2?form.getContent());
??????ps.executeUpdate();
??????ps.close();
????}
????catch?(SQLException?ex)?{
????}
??}
//以數據庫流水號為條件查詢信息
??public?AfficheForm?selectOneAffiche(Integer?id)?{
????AfficheForm?affiche?=?null;
????try?{
??????ps?=?connection.prepareStatement(FinalConstants.affice_selectOne);
??????ps.setInt(1?id.intValue());
??????ResultSet?rs?=?ps.executeQuery();
??????while?(rs.next())?{
????????affiche?=?new?AfficheForm();
????????affiche.setId(Integer.valueOf(rs.getString(1)));
????????affiche.setName(rs.getString(2));
????????affiche.setContent(rs.getString(3));
????????affiche.setIssueTime(rs.getString(4));
??????}
????}
????catch?(SQLException?ex)?{
????}
????return?affiche;
??}
//全部查詢的方法
??public?List?selectAffiche()?{
????List?list?=?new?ArrayList();
????AfficheForm?affiche?=?null;
????try?{
??????ps?=?connection.prepareStatement(FinalConstants.affiche_select);
??????ResultSet?rs?=?ps.executeQuery();
??????while?(rs.next())?{
????????affiche?=?new?AfficheForm();
????????affiche.setId(Integer.valueOf(rs.getString(1)));
????????affiche.setName(rs.getString(2));
????????affiche.setContent(rs.getString(3));
????????affiche.setIssueTime(rs.getString(4));
????????list.add(affiche);
??????}
????}
????catch?(SQLException?ex)?{
????}
????return?list;
??}
}
?屬性????????????大小?????日期????時間???名稱
-----------?---------??----------?-----??----
?????文件???????2417??2018-06-27?15:40??marketplace\.classpath
?????文件????????306??2008-12-03?12:09??marketplace\.myme
?????文件????????262??2008-12-05?22:08??marketplace\.mystrutsdata
?????文件???????1837??2018-06-27?01:10??marketplace\.project
?????文件????????500??2008-12-03?09:30??marketplace\.settings\.jsdtscope
?????文件????????390??2018-06-27?01:10??marketplace\.settings\com.genuitec.eclipse.migration.prefs
?????文件?????????55??2018-06-27?01:14??marketplace\.settings\org.eclipse.core.resources.prefs
?????文件????????334??2008-12-03?09:30??marketplace\.settings\org.eclipse.jdt.core.prefs
?????文件????????637??2018-06-27?01:10??marketplace\.settings\org.eclipse.wst.common.component
?????文件????????354??2018-07-01?17:59??marketplace\.settings\org.eclipse.wst.common.project.facet.core.xm
?????文件????????411??2018-06-27?01:10??marketplace\.settings\org.eclipse.wst.common.project.facet.core.xm
?????文件?????????49??2008-12-03?09:30??marketplace\.settings\org.eclipse.wst.jsdt.ui.superType.container
?????文件??????????6??2008-12-03?09:30??marketplace\.settings\org.eclipse.wst.jsdt.ui.superType.name
?????文件???????3091??2007-01-15?11:16??marketplace\src\com\dao\AfficheDao.class
?????文件???????2725??2008-12-07?09:58??marketplace\src\com\dao\AfficheDao.java
?????文件???????3301??2007-01-15?11:16??marketplace\src\com\dao\BigTypeDao.class
?????文件???????2939??2008-01-06?00:53??marketplace\src\com\dao\BigTypeDao.java
?????文件???????6502??2007-01-15?11:16??marketplace\src\com\dao\GoodsDao.class
?????文件???????7967??2008-12-04?17:02??marketplace\src\com\dao\GoodsDao.java
?????文件???????3621??2007-01-15?11:16??marketplace\src\com\dao\li
?????文件???????3432??2008-12-04?17:02??marketplace\src\com\dao\li
?????文件???????3815??2007-01-15?11:16??marketplace\src\com\dao\ManagerDao.class
?????文件???????3795??2008-01-06?00:53??marketplace\src\com\dao\ManagerDao.java
?????文件???????5427??2007-01-15?11:16??marketplace\src\com\dao\MemberDao.class
?????文件???????6352??2008-12-06?20:43??marketplace\src\com\dao\MemberDao.java
?????文件???????4384??2007-01-15?11:16??marketplace\src\com\dao\OrderDao.class
?????文件???????4284??2008-12-04?17:04??marketplace\src\com\dao\OrderDao.java
?????文件???????3091??2007-01-15?11:16??marketplace\src\com\dao\OrderDetailDao.class
?????文件???????1977??2008-12-04?17:04??marketplace\src\com\dao\OrderDetailDao.java
?????文件???????3901??2007-01-15?11:16??marketplace\src\com\dao\SmallTypeDao.class
............此處省略297個文件信息
評論
共有 條評論